LISTING ARCHIVED, part of trails closed. A Wherigo in the Withlacoochee State Forest. A walk in the woods of about 3 miles most of it on maintained trail or two track, but part of the journey is rough, ~.3 off trail. Companion cart to GC1BNZE.

About This Cartridge

This adventure will take you to some of the rarely seen parts of this property. Some fabulous old hammocks, some early settler artifacts.

Version 1.2 May 15, includes completion code for Wherigo logging. Cartridge has been run on Garmin Oregon, Colorado, Nuvi, a variety of Pocket PCs, the iPhone and Android.
